Rangers have high expectations for Uddingston's Alex Lowry - and Scotland u21s boss Scot Gemmill can see why.
Scot Gemmill is excited about working with Alex Lowry for the first time after including the Rangers winger in the Scotland Under-21 squad.

Rangers boss Gio van Bronckhorst used the final day of the Premiership season to offer first-team chances to a host of young talent on Saturday.
Journalist Joshua Barrie has praised Rangers youngster Alex Lowry for his performance against Hearts which saw the 18-year-old bag a goal in the first half as Rangers eased to a 3-1 victory.
